Curtains Fall as Beloved Kenyan Comedienne Tabitha Gatwiri is Finally Laid to Rest

  • As the song ‘Kwake Yesu Nasimama’ echoed through the air, the last shovel of earth was poured over Tabitha Gatwiri’s resting place
  • The sight of her casket being lowered was too much for many to bear, and friends and family collapsed into each other’s arms, overwhelmed by the magnitude of the loss
  • Her grieving mother, after being ushered by the pastor to throw a mould of soil onto the grave, was seen making a prayer as grief continued to reign

The planting of flowers, following a session of filling the grave with soil, marked the final rites that sealed the closing of the book of life for the beloved Kenyan comedienne, Tabitha Gatwiri.

Her burial took place in a remote village in Meru County, exactly two weeks after her untimely death at the KU Hospital.

The event was deeply emotional, with attendees breaking down in tears at various moments, while others, unable to contain their grief, wailed loudly.

Her family, particularly her mother, were the most affected.

Though she had maintained her composure throughout the ceremony, she was visibly shaken when her daughter’s white casket was lowered into the grave.

Celebrities, including Kelvin Kinuthia, Naomi Kuria, Shiphira, and MCA Tricky, attended the ceremony in large numbers, offering moving tributes and reminiscing about the beautiful memories they shared with Tabitha.

MCA Tricky, on behalf of the celebrity community, read a heartfelt tribute during the somber occasion.

The day had started off slowly, amid rain showers at the Calm Breeze Funeral Home in Meru, where Tabitha’s body had been moved from the KU Hospital morgue.

Her white casket was lowered gently using a crane, and mourners crowded around for one final glimpse.

As the casket was set into the ground, the pastor led a ritual in which family members first placed a mound of soil on the casket.

A video that has surfaced on TikTok captures the emotional moment, with voices wailing in the background as many mourners cried out in unison.

Her grave was then filled with soil, and the final chapter was closed with the planting of a beautifully emblazoned cross, marking the dates when her book of life opened and when it tragically closed.
